UNIXオペレーティングシステムの機能

...

Intelによれば、高い信頼性、スケーラビリティ、および強力な機能により、UNIXは人気のあるオペレーティングシステムになっています。 UNIXは2010年の40年を超えて、インターネットを含む多くのデータセンターのバックボーンとなっています。 UNIXを使用している大手企業には、Sun Microsystems、Apple Inc.、Hewlett-Packard、およびUNIXの元々の親会社であるAT&Tが含まれます。 Open Groupは、インターネットを介して自由にアクセスおよび利用できるすべてのUNIX仕様および商標を所有しています。

マルチタスクと移植性

UNIXの主な機能には、マルチユーザー、マルチタスク、および移植性の機能が含まれます。 複数のユーザーが端末と呼ばれるポイントに接続してシステムにアクセスします。 複数のユーザーが1つのシステムで複数のプログラムまたはプロセスを同時に実行できます。 UNIXは、理解、変更、および他のマシンへの転送が容易な高級言語を使用しています。 つまり、新しいハードウェアの要件に応じて言語コードを変更できます コンピューター。 したがって、任意のハードウェアを選択し、それに応じてUNIXコードを変更し、複数のアーキテクチャでUNIXを使用する柔軟性があります。

今日のビデオ

カーネルとシェル

UNIXオペレーティングシステムのハブであるカーネルは、システム上のアプリケーションと周辺機器を管理します。 カーネルとシェルが一緒になって、要求とコマンドを実行します。 UNIXシェルを介してシステムと通信します。UNIXシェルはカーネルに変換されます。 端末の電源を入れると、入力を見落とすシステムプロセスが開始されます。 パスワードを入力すると、システムはシェルプログラムを端末に関連付けます。 シェルを使用すると、技術的に精通していない場合でもオプションをカスタマイズできます。 たとえば、コマンドを部分的に入力すると、シェルは目的のコマンドを予測し、コマンドを表示します。 UNIXシェルは、プロンプトを表示および表示し、カーネルと連携してコマンドを実行するプログラムです。 シェルは入力したコマンドの履歴も保持しているため、コマンドの履歴をスクロールしてコマンドを再利用できます。

ファイルとプロセス

UNIXのすべての機能には、ファイルまたはプロセスが含まれます。 プロセスはプログラムの実行であり、ファイルはユーザーが作成したデータのコレクションです。 ファイルには、ドキュメント、システムのプログラミング手順、またはディレクトリが含まれる場合があります。 UNIXは、ルートディレクトリで始まる階層ファイル構造を設計に使用しています。これはスラッシュ(/)で示されます。 ルートの後には、逆ツリーのようにサブディレクトリが続き、ファイルで終わります。 「/Demand/Articles/UNIX.doc」の例では、メインディレクトリ「Demand」にはサブディレクトリ「Articles」があり、そのサブディレクトリには「UNIX.doc」というファイルがあります。